Blues legend Buddy Guy, seen here performing at The Saint
Augustine Amphitheatre. Guy is one history’s most revered guitar and is largely
associated with the Chicago electric blues scene. His playing has influenced
the likes of Jimi Hendrix and Eric Clapton, as well as many modern Rock n Roll
artists. Inducted into the Rock N Roll Hall of Fame in 2006, Buddy Guy
continues to tour and entertain audiences all over the world.
Jonny Lang released
his multi-platinum album Lie to Me in
1996, and was only 15 at the time. Lang is known for his authoritative guitar playing,
as well as his uniquely soulful voice. Over the course of his career, Jonny Lang
has collaborated with some of the best guitar players of all time, and also took
home a Grammy Award in 2006.
